Pu Wang is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ials.
According to data from OpenAlex, Pu Wang has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 283 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 11 papers in Materials Chemistry and 10 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. Recurrent topics in Pu Wang’s work include Metallic Glasses and Amorphous Alloys (17 papers), Metallurgical Processes and Thermodynamics (12 papers) and Magnetic Properties of Alloys (7 papers). Pu Wang is often cited by papers focused on Metallic Glasses and Amorphous Alloys (17 papers), Metallurgical Processes and Thermodynamics (12 papers) and Magnetic Properties of Alloys (7 papers). Pu Wang collaborates with scholars based in China. Pu Wang's co-authors include Jiaquan Zhang, Jing Pang, Jiaqi Liu, H. Xiao and Haiyan Tang and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emical Engineering Journal, Journal of Alloys and Compounds and Journal of Non-Crystalline Solids.
